Decoding the Volvo EC290's Powerful Engine Control Unit

The Volvo EC290 is renowned for its exceptional performance, a quality directly attributed to its sophisticated Hydraulic Control Unit (ECU). This advanced electronic system serves as the brains of the machine, meticulously managing numerous vital parameters to ensure optimal power delivery and fuel efficiency.

The EC290's ECU utilizes cutting-edge technology to analyze a vast array of real-time data, including engine speed, load, temperature, and hydraulic pressure. Based on this information, the ECU precisely adjusts parameters such as fuel injection timing, turbocharger boost, and hydraulic flow to achieve maximum performance in any given situation.

This intricate system allows operators to benefit from seamless power delivery, smooth operation, and reduced fuel consumption. By decoding the workings of the EC290's powerful ECU, we can gain a deeper insight into the machine's remarkable capabilities.

Resolving Volvo Excavators: VECU Diagnostics and Solutions

When a modern excavator starts exhibiting symptoms, it can quickly stall productivity. Luckily, the Vehicle Electronic Control Unit (VECU) provides invaluable information into potential causes. Utilizing specialized diagnostic tools and procedures, technicians can pinpoint malfunctions within the VECU system and implement effective corrections. This process often involves analyzing fault codes, monitoring sensor data, and executing checks on various components.

By understanding oneself with VECU diagnostics, technicians can efficiently identify and resolve issues, minimizing downtime and maximizing the operational efficiency of Volvo excavators.
